Application of Sintered Filter Products
Sintered filters are used in a wide range of industries, including chemical processing, petroleum refining, power generation, and pharmaceutical production. They are ideal for use in applications where a high level of filtration efficiency is required, and where the filter must be able to withstand high temperatures, pressures, and corrosive environments. Some of the most common applications of sintered filter products include:
Liquid Filtration
Sintered metal filters are commonly used for liquid filtration in a variety of industries. They are particularly useful in applications where the liquid being filtered is viscous or contains a high level of solids. Sintered filters can remove particles as small as 1 micron, making them ideal for use in applications where a high level of filtration efficiency is required.
Fluidizing
Sintered metal filters can also be used for fluidizing applications, where they help to evenly distribute gas or liquid through a bed of solid particles. This is particularly useful in applications such as catalysis, where it is important to ensure that all reactants are evenly distributed.
Sparging
Sintered metal filters can also be used for sparging applications, where they help to introduce gas into a liquid. This is particularly useful in applications such as fermentation, where it is important to ensure that the liquid being fermented is well-aerated.
Diffusion
Sintered metal filters can also be used for diffusion applications, where they help to evenly distribute gas or liquid through a membrane. This is particularly useful in applications such as fuel cells, where it is important to ensure that the reactants are evenly distributed across the membrane.
Flame Arrestor
Sintered metal filters can also be used as flame arrestors, where they help to prevent the spread of flames or explosions. This is particularly useful in applications such as refineries or chemical plants, where flammable materials are present.
Gas Filtration
Sintered metal filters are also used for gas filtration in a wide range of industrial applications. They are particularly useful in applications where the gas being filtered contains a high level of moisture or other contaminants. Sintered filters can remove particles as small as 0.1 micron, making them ideal for use in applications where a high level of filtration efficiency is required.
Food and Beverage
Sintered metal filters are also used in a variety of food and beverage applications, including the filtration of beer, wine, and other beverages. They are particularly useful in applications where a high level of filtration efficiency is required, and where the filter must be able to withstand high temperatures and corrosive environments.

4-Tips When Choose & OEM Sintered Metal Filter You Should Care
There are several ways to customize sintered metal filters to meet specific application requirements.
Some common methods include:
1. Selecting the appropriate metal:
Different metals have different properties that can affect the performance of the
sintered metal filter. For example, stainless steel is corrosion-resistant and has a high melting point, while
aluminum is lightweight and has good electrical conductivity.
2. Specifying the pore size and shape:
Sintered metal filters can be designed with pores of different sizes and
shapes to suit different filtration needs. For example, a filter with smaller pores will be more effective at removing
smaller particles, while a filter with larger pores may be more suitable for high flow rates.
3. Varying the filter media thickness:
The thickness of the filter media can also be adjusted to suit specific
application requirements. Thicker media can provide greater filtration efficiency but may also result in higher
pressure drop and reduced flow rates.
4. Adjusting the temperature and pressure conditions:
Sintered metal filters can be designed to withstand specific
temperature and pressure conditions, depending on the application. It is important to consider these factors when
selecting a filter to ensure that it can withstand the system's operating conditions.

3. How is a Sintered Metal Filter Made ?
For the manufacturing process of Sintered metal filter, main have 3-steps as follow:
A: First step is to get the power metal.
The metal powder, You can obtain metal powders by grinding, automation, or chemical decomposition. You can combine one metal
powder with another metal to form an alloy during the fabrication process, or you can use only one powder. The advantage of sintering is that
it does not change the physical properties of the metal material. The process is so simple that the metal elements are not altered.
B: Stamping
The second step is to pour the metal powder into a pre-prepared mold in which you can shape the filter. The filter assembly is formed at room
temperature and under stamping. The amount of pressure applied depends on the metal you are using, as different metals have different elasticity.
After a high-pressure impact, the metal powder is compacted in the mold to form a solid filter. After the high-pressure impact procedure, you can
place the prepared metal filter in a high-temperature furnace.
C: High-temperature sintering
In the sintering process, the metal particles are fused to form a single unit without reaching the melting point. This monolith is as strong,
rigid, and porous a filter as the metal.
You can control the porosity of the filter by the process according to the flow level of the air or liquid to be filtered.

8. Can a Sintered Metal Filter Continue to Work Even when the Conditions are Freezing?
Yes, for sintered metal finter, such as 316L sintered stainless steel filter can work under
-70 ℃~ +600℃ , so for most of sintered filter can work under freezong. but need to ensure
Liquid and gas can flow under the freezing condition.
